Two towns work to become age-friendly

MAPLEWOOD, NJ — South Orange and Maplewood will jointly host a community forum to discuss “SOMA – Becoming Age-Friendly Communities.” This event, funded by the Grotta Fund for Senior Care, will address services for older adults and will serve as a springboard for ideas about how the two towns can address the changing needs of residents as they age in the communities.

The forum will be Sunday, June 5, from 2 to 4 p.m., at The Woodland, 60 Woodland Road in Maplewood. Light refreshments will be served.
